    Remote Control Wall-Mount Enclosure-Cooling Air Conditioners

    Image of Product. Shown with Controller and Adapter. Front orientation. Air Conditioners. Remote Control Wall-Mount Enclosure-Cooling Air Conditioners.

    Shown with Controller and Adapter

    Keep your equipment cool in hard-to-reach enclosures. These air conditioners include an adapter and temperature controller, so you can monitor temperatures and manage settings and alarms remotely. You can integrate them into your facility's network or a programmable logic controller (PLC). If you'd rather control them from your laptop, use their RJ45 connection (cord not included). Use a bracket to mount the adapter and controller to a DIN rail on a nearby panel.
    3,600 BTU/hr Cooling Capacity and 5,100 BTU/hr Cooling Capacity—Air conditioners with 3,600 and 5,100 BTU/hr. cooling capacity require two openings for installation.

    Enclosure Thermostats for Multiple Devices

    Keep electronics in your enclosure from getting too hot or cold with these thermostats that control two devices at once. Clip them to a DIN rail to install.
    For Heating and Cooling Thermostats with One Actuation Point
    Image of Product. Adjustable Thermostat with One Actuation Point. Front orientation. Thermostats. Enclosure Thermostats for Multiple Devices, 1 Actuation Point, Adjustable Actuation Point.

    Adjustable Thermostat

    with One Actuation Point

    Heating and cooling thermostats control heaters and fans or air conditioners.
    Thermostats with one actuation point, also known as changeover thermostats, switch between heating and cooling so one device is always running. When the temperature in your enclosure gets hotter than the temperature you set, the thermostat will turn on your fan or air conditioner. It goes back to heating once the temperature is reduced by the temperature difference. So for a thermostat with a temperature difference of 9° F, setting it at 60° F means it will heat the enclosure until it reaches 60° F, switch to cooling until it reaches 51° F, and then switch back to heating.
    Adjustable Actuation Point—Adjustable thermostats allow you to set custom temperatures.
    IP20 Enclosure Rating—All thermostats meet IP20, which means they’re designed so fingers can’t fit inside and get shocked.
    UL 94 V-0—They also meet UL 94 V-0, so they self-extinguish within 10 seconds if they catch fire and won’t spread the fire by dripping.
    Certification—Thermostats that are CE marked or VDE certified meet European safety standards. UL Recognized Component and C-UL Recognized Component thermostats also meet American and Canadian safety standards.

    For Heating and Cooling Thermostats with Two Actuation Points
    Image of Product. Adjustable Thermostat with Two Actuation Points. Front orientation. Thermostats. Enclosure Thermostats for Multiple Devices, 2 Actuation Points, Adjustable Actuation Point.
    Image of Product. Fixed Thermostat. Front orientation. Thermostats. Enclosure Thermostats for Multiple Devices, 2 Actuation Points, Fixed Actuation Point.

    Adjustable Thermostat

    with Two Actuation Points

    Fixed Thermostat

    Cooling thermostats regulate two cooling devices, such as a fan and an air conditioner, for two-stage cooling. Use only one device for cooling in mild temperatures or both for extreme heat. These thermostats switch your equipment on when the enclosure is hotter than the temperature setting. Once the temperature is reduced by the temperature difference, it will switch off. For example, a thermostat set at 77° F for a fan and 140° F for an air conditioner will power both devices when the enclosure is over 140° F. With a temperature difference of 18° F, the air conditioner will switch off when the temperature goes below 122° F. The fan will run until the temperature reaches 59° F, and switch back on if it heats up to 77° F or hotter.
    Heating and cooling thermostats control heaters and fans or air conditioners.
    Heating and cooling thermostats with two actuation points control two devices independently. When your enclosure temperature is within the set range, neither device is powered, so they’re more efficient than changeover thermostats. For each device, temperature setting is the high end of the temperature range, and temperature difference is the size of the range. For a thermostat with temperature settings of 59° and 95° F and an 18° F temperature difference, the heater will switch on when your enclosure is colder than 41° F and turn off when it reaches 59° F. The fan or other cooling device will switch on when the temperature goes above 95° F and turn off once the enclosure cools to 77° F.
    Adjustable Actuation Point—Adjustable thermostats allow you to set custom temperatures.
    Fixed Actuation Point—Fixed thermostats prevent tampering and accidental changes.
    IP20 Enclosure Rating—All thermostats meet IP20, which means they’re designed so fingers can’t fit inside and get shocked.
    UL 94 V-0—They also meet UL 94 V-0, so they self-extinguish within 10 seconds if they catch fire and won’t spread the fire by dripping.
    Certification—Thermostats that are CE marked or VDE certified meet European safety standards. UL Recognized Component and C-UL Recognized Component thermostats also meet American and Canadian safety standards.

    Enclosure Thermostats

    Image of ProductInUse. Adjustable Thermostat (12.6° F Temperature Difference). Front orientation. Thermostats. Enclosure Thermostats, Adjustable Actuation Point, 12.6° F Temperature Difference.
    Image of ProductInUse. Adjustable Thermostat (7° F Temperature Difference). Front orientation. Thermostats. Enclosure Thermostats, Adjustable Actuation Point, 7° F Temperature Difference.

    Adjustable Thermostat

    (12.6° F Temperature

    Difference)

    Adjustable Thermostat

    (7° F Temperature

    Difference)

    Image of ProductInUse. Fixed Thermostat. Front orientation. Thermostats. Enclosure Thermostats, Fixed Actuation Point.

    Fixed Thermostat

    Control a single heating or cooling device in your enclosure to keep electronics at a safe operating temperature. Clip them on to a DIN rail and connect them to your heater, fan, or air conditioner. All these thermostats meet American, Canadian, or European safety standards.
    Cooling—Cooling thermostats are normally open, so they’ll switch your fan or air conditioner on when the air in your enclosure reaches the temperature setting.
    Adjustable Actuation Point—Adjustable thermostats let you set the temperature you need.
    Fixed Actuation Point—Fixed thermostats have a fixed temperature setting to prevent tampering or accidental changes.
    IP20 Enclosure Rating—They have an IP20 rating—to prevent shocks, fingers won’t fit inside.
    UL 94 V-0—They also meet UL 94 V-0, so they self-extinguish within 10 seconds if they catch fire and won’t spread the fire by dripping.
    Temperature Setting—These thermostats keep the air in your enclosure within a set range. Temperature setting is the high end of the range for both heating and cooling thermostats.
    Temperature Difference—Temperature difference is the difference between the temperature when the thermostat turns your device on and when it turns off. For a heater thermostat with a temperature setting of 50° and an 18° temperature difference, the thermostat will switch your heater on when the temperature goes below 32° and off once the temperature reaches 50°. Thermostats with a lower temperature difference maintain a narrower range of temperatures, but they use more power because they switch on and off more frequently.
